Quote:
Originally Posted by Chad86 View Post
So which fits better? The TRD or the Covercraft?
Is $50 more worth it? Is the TRD one piece? The TRD looks cleaner without fold lines. Also, it appears to fill in around the mirror.
The TRD definitely wasn't worth the extra $50 to me. The Covercraft is thick, folds right behind the passenger seat, and I like how it has the cutout around the mirror because it keeps space there for an alarm system or dash cam.
